St Bernard's Catholic Primary School profile summary

St Bernard's Catholic Primary School is listed as a catholic primary school in Botany, New South Wales. The profile reports 287 total enrolments, an ICSEA value of 1,119, and a student-teacher ratio of 17.3:1 where available. The reported year range is K-6, and the campus sits within Bayside (NSW) local government area.
